Product Description
The Dell 462-7441 is a high-performance quad-port Gigabit Ethernet network interface card designed for server environments. Equipped with four independent 10/100/1000 Mbps Ethernet ports, this card significantly enhances a server's network connectivity, allowing for increased bandwidth, redundancy, and the ability to connect to multiple networks simultaneously. The card utilizes the PCI-Express (PCIe) interface, providing ample bandwidth to support the aggregate throughput of all four Gigabit Ethernet ports without becoming a bottleneck. This makes it suitable for demanding server applications such as virtualization, network-attached storage (NAS), high-performance computing, and high-traffic web servers. The multiple ports can be used for network teaming (link aggregation) to increase throughput and provide failover capabilities, or for connecting to different network segments. Designed for reliability and performance, the Dell 462-7441 is typically compatible with a wide range of Dell PowerEdge servers and supports various operating systems. Features like Wake-on-LAN (WoL) and PXE boot support further enhance its utility in managed server environments. This NIC provides a cost-effective and efficient solution for expanding server network capabilities and improving overall network infrastructure performance.
